Coues Rhipidomys vs Red-tailed Ant-Thrush

Rhipidomys couesi compared with Neocossyphus rufus

Taxonomic Classification

Rank Coues Rhipidomys Red-tailed Ant-Thrush
Kingdom same Animalia (Animals) Animalia (Animals)
Phylum same Chordata (Chordates) Chordata (Chordates)
Class Mammalia (Mammals) Aves (Birds)
Order Rodentia (Rodents) Passeriformes (Songbirds)
Family Cricetidae Turdidae
Genus Rhipidomys Neocossyphus
Species Rhipidomys couesi Neocossyphus rufus

Evolutionary Relationship

Coues Rhipidomys and Red-tailed Ant-Thrush share a common ancestor at the Phylum level: Chordata. (Chordates)
